What affects the price

Roof repair costs depend on several specific factors. The size of the damaged area is the biggest variable, along with the accessibility of your roof and the pitch or steepness involved. We also look at the underlying materials—like whether you have standard asphalt shingles, metal, or tile—and the complexity of the flashing around chimneys or vents. What are the benefits of polycarbonate roof panels?

Polycarbonate roof panels offer excellent impact resistance and light transmission, making them suitable for applications like patio covers, greenhouses, or skylights where durability and natural light are priorities. They are lighter than glass and can be easily installed. While offering good weather resistance, they may not be the ideal primary roofing material for entire homes in Fayetteville due to potential long-term UV degradation and scratching compared to more traditional roofing systems. They are best utilized for specific architectural features.

What are the best RV roof sealant options?

For RV roofs in Fayetteville, durable and weather-resistant sealants are essential. EPDM rubber roof sealants are specifically designed for the flexible nature of RV roofing membranes, providing a watertight seal against rain and UV exposure. Dicor is a common brand known for its self-leveling lap sealant, ideal for covering fasteners and seams. For metal RV roofs, a high-quality silicone or modified bitumen sealant can offer excellent adhesion and flexibility. Proper cleaning and application are critical for long-lasting protection.

What are the benefits of TPO roofing?

TPO (Thermoplastic Olefin) roofing is a popular choice for commercial and flat-roofed residential properties in Fayetteville due to its energy efficiency and durability. Its reflective surface helps reduce cooling costs by minimizing heat absorption. TPO membranes are resistant to punctures, tears, and UV exposure, offering a long service life. The seams are heat-welded, creating a strong, monolithic barrier that effectively prevents water intrusion, making it a reliable and cost-effective solution for low-slope applications.

What are the common types of roof shingles?

The most common types of roof shingles include asphalt shingles, which are widely used due to their affordability and availability in various styles like 3-tab and architectural. Architectural shingles offer enhanced durability and aesthetic appeal with their layered design. Other options include wood shakes, slate tiles, metal shingles, and composite materials, each providing different levels of longevity, appearance, and resistance to weather elements like those experienced in Fayetteville.
